6

この質問と同様: Visual Studio で Boost ソース コードへのデバッグを回避するにはどうすればよいですか?

しかし、どうすればXcodeでそれを行うことができますか?

ありがとう、ジム

4

1 に答える 1

15

重要なのは lldb 設定target.process.thread.step-avoid-regexpです。私の Mac では、これにはデフォルト値があり^std::ました。lldb と入力してsettings show target.process.thread.step-avoid-regexp. とにかく、できることは ~/.lldbinit を編集して、まだ存在しない場合は作成し、次のような行を追加することです

settings set target.process.thread.step-avoid-regexp ^(std::|boost::shared_ptr)

これにより、std:: にステップ インしないという以前の動作が保持され、shared_ptr にもステップ インしません。

于 2013-03-22T00:39:25.697 に答える